May Day Actions Across Various Regions in Indonesia
Workers in a convoy during the Labour Day commemoration in Surabaya, East Java, on Friday (1/5/2026). The labour masses voiced several aspirations, including rejecting low wages and the abolition of the outsourcing system. ANTARA PHOTO/Didik Suhartono/hma
Workers from the United Labour Communication Forum of DIY held a peaceful action to commemorate International Labour Day at the White Pal Tugu, Yogyakarta, on Friday (1/5/2026). In the action, they voiced several demands, including the immediate ratification of the Labour Bill and fair wages for workers. ANTARA PHOTO/Andreas Fitri Atmoko/hma
Several students from the Front for the Struggle for Democracy read a statement in front of the police during an action to commemorate International Labour Day or May Day 2026 at the Ternate Mayor’s Office, North Maluku, on Friday (1/5/2026). In their action, they highlighted various demands in the North Maluku region, including the seizure of living spaces for farmers and fishermen, touching on work accident cases in several mining companies in Halmahera, and resolving clean water issues in Ternate. Several workers carried demand posters during a rally to commemorate International Labour Day or May Day 2026 at the Adipura Tugu in Bandar Lampung, Lampung, on Friday (1/5/2026). In May Day 2026, the workers demanded the ratification of the Labour Bill, abolition of outsourcing, provision of protection and social security for workers, rejection of low wages, and concerns over the impact of global conflicts that could trigger waves of layoffs (PHK). A journalist spoke through a loudspeaker to convey aspirations during a peaceful action commemorating Labour Day in Kendari, Southeast Sulawesi, on Friday (1/5/2026). The peaceful action, attended by several press organisations including AJI Kendari, IJTI Sultra, and the Student Press Institute of IAIN Kendari, highlighted low welfare guarantees as well as rejection of mass layoffs (PHK) without severance pay for journalists. Several workers rested near the Marsinah statue during a pilgrimage to the grave of national hero Marsinah in Nglundo Village, Nganjuk Regency, East Java, on Friday (1/5/2026). Hundreds of workers from various regions conducted a pilgrimage to the grave of this labour fighter to commemorate International Labour Day. ANTARA PHOTO/Prasetia Fauzani/hma
Several protesters burned tyres during the International Labour Day commemoration in front of the Central Sulawesi Governor’s Office in Palu, Central Sulawesi, on Friday (1/5/2026). The action, attended by hundreds of representatives from labour organisations and students, demanded an increase in the minimum wage, abolition of contract and outsourcing work systems, and improved protection and welfare for workers. Several masses carried posters while joining a rally to commemorate International Labour Day (May Day) in front of the Central Java Governor’s Office Complex and the Central Java DPRD, Semarang City, Central Java, on Friday (1/5/2026). The action, attended by a coalition of civil society, students, labour unions, and media workers, voiced various demands including the abolition of the outsourcing system, fair wages and protection for journalists, and improved welfare for workers throughout Indonesia.
